Catalog description

Learners will gain advanced knowledge and practical skills in neurological rehabilitation designed for physical therapist assistants. They deepen their understanding of neurological function and participate in hands-on experiences assisting individuals with neurologic disorders across the lifespan. Learners will support treatment planning, apply current therapeutic approaches, and promote safe, effective care for individuals with neurological impairments. Emphasis is placed on integrating intervention techniques, health promotion strategies, and understanding how social determinants of health impact patient outcomes in a variety of clinical settings. Two and a half lecture hours and five lab hours per week.
